Midland Metropolitan Hospital PF2 re-tender scrapped

A planned new PF2 competition for the recently-cancelled Midland Metropolitan hospital contract with bankrupt Carillion has been scrapped. Sandwell & West Birmingham Hospitals NHS Trust says initial soundings with contractors suggested a PF2 bid would cost £424 million ($552 million)...
